AR M I N G AN D S T AY I N G W I T H A F AU L T E D Z O N E
Perhaps you want to arm the system and stay within the premises, but wish to intentionally leave a door open with all other
perimeter protection secure. These open "faulted" zone(s), may be temporarily removed from the system ("bypassed").
Remember, all bypassed zones--doors, windows, etc.--are unprotected.

WARNING: When bypassing a monitored door, be aware that the bypassed door is temporarily removed from the system
and will not send a disarm signal to the Touchpad when unlocked, and false alarms may result. Therefore, an I-FOB MUST
be used to disarm when entering through a bypassed monitored door.

Press the BYPASS button. The LCD window will
read "DISPLAY ZN DIRECTORY Y/N".
Press NO and the next menu selection "BYPASS ALL OPEN ZONES Y/N" appears. Press YES to bypass
all open perimeter zones (excluding the primary exit/entry door).
Press STAY--or--press and hold STAY for 2 seconds to arm instantly.
Close and lock the primary exit/entry door deadbolt to arm the system with the faulted
zone(s) bypassed.
